General Information: Propionibacterium freudenreichii is a member of the "dairy propionibacteria", commonly isolated from cheese and other dairy products. Propionibacterium freudenreichii subsp. shermanii, formerly Propionibacterium shermanii, is important for the development of flavor and the characteristic holes in Swiss cheese. In addition, Propionibacterium freudenreichii subsp. shermanii has been used as a probiotic for humans and animals and may have a role in preventing of colon cancer.
